American vocalists Diane Hall and Anitta Ray had performed with the Ray Anthony band as ‘The Bookends’ several years prior to their waxing of this tune, based upon a melodic passage in Clementi’s ‘Sonatina in G Major, op. 36 no. 5’ and credited to songwriters Toni Wine & Carole Bayer (Sager). Strangely, the track was issued only on the French EP “One By One.” In 1966 the song became a major hit for the UK group The Mindbenders:    • 1966 HITS ARCHIVE: A Groovy Kind Of L...   and again in 1988 for Phil Collins    • A Groovy Kind Of Love  

Original issue on (French) Vogue EP 18035 - Groovy Kind Of Love (Toni Wine-Carole Bayer) by Diane & Annita
